Strategic Sourcing Guide for Luxury Mobile Ice Cream Carts with Non-Slip Flooring
Understanding the Technical Landscape of Mobile Ice Cream Units
When sourcing a luxury mobile ice cream cart, the primary objective is to identify equipment that balances aesthetic appeal with rigorous functional performance. The core requirement of non-slip flooring is not merely a safety feature but a critical operational necessity for units that must remain stable while being pushed or pulled across various surfaces, from smooth indoor floors to uneven outdoor pavements. Based on the available market data, these units are predominantly designed for the production and display of frozen treats such as ice cream, kulfi, and Turkish ice cream. The technical specifications observed in the current supply chain indicate a diverse range of models, including the MR6 and HT-KNB6, which serve different operational needs.
The power requirements for these units are a significant technical variable. Some models operate on a specific 0.65kw electric power source with a voltage of 220V 50Hz, suitable for regions with standard single-phase power. In contrast, other units are engineered with broader voltage compatibility, supporting 110V, 220V, or 380V inputs. This flexibility is essential for buyers operating in international markets or planning to deploy units in locations with varying electrical infrastructure. The automatic grade of these machines varies, with some classified as fully automatic and others as manual. The choice between automatic and manual grades often dictates the labor intensity and the consistency of the final product, particularly when dealing with hard ice cream or gelato.
The physical dimensions of the carts are equally critical for logistics and spatial planning. Observed standard dimensions include configurations such as 1370740(920+930)mm and 120010001370mm. For mobile units intended for high-traffic areas, the weight is a defining characteristic; one observed model weighs 260kg, which necessitates a robust chassis and high-quality braking casters. The wheel configuration typically involves four wheels, often equipped with braking casters to ensure the unit remains stationary during service. The non-slip flooring requirement must be integrated into the design of the service counter or the interior workspace, ensuring that staff can move safely even when the cart is in motion or when liquids are present.
Compliance and Certification Verification Protocols
In the B2B procurement of food service equipment, compliance with international safety and quality standards is non-negotiable. The supply chain for luxury mobile ice cream carts demonstrates a reliance on specific certifications to validate product safety and operational integrity. The most frequently observed certification in the current market data is the CE mark, which indicates conformity with health, safety, and environmental protection standards for products sold within the European Economic Area. Some listings also reference ISOCE, suggesting adherence to specific organizational or industry standards, though the exact scope of this certification requires direct verification with the supplier.
Buyers must also scrutinize the presence of DOT (Department of Transportation) certification, particularly for units intended for road transport or those that may be classified as vehicles in certain jurisdictions. The combination of CE and DOT certifications in a single product listing suggests a dual-purpose design that meets both industrial safety standards and transportation regulations. However, the absence of these certifications in a listing does not automatically disqualify a product, but it necessitates a rigorous request for documentation to ensure the unit meets the local regulatory requirements of the buyer's destination country.
The material composition of the cart is a primary driver of compliance. The use of 304 stainless steel is a standard observation in high-quality units, offering resistance to corrosion and ease of cleaning, which is vital for food safety compliance. The "Fumigation-Free Wooden Case" and "Wooden Box" packing standards observed in the data indicate that suppliers are aware of international phytosanitary regulations, which is crucial for cross-border shipping. Buyers should verify that the materials used for the non-slip flooring and the structural frame meet local food safety codes, ensuring that no harmful substances leach into the product during operation.
Cost Drivers and Pricing Dynamics in the Luxury Segment
The pricing of luxury mobile ice cream carts is influenced by a complex interplay of factors, including material quality, customization levels, and technical specifications. The observed price range in the current market spans from $1,100 to $5,255 USD. This wide variance reflects the difference between basic manual units and fully automated, highly customized luxury models. The lower end of the spectrum likely corresponds to units with manual grades and standard dimensions, while the higher end encompasses models with smart thermostats, automatic grades, and extensive customization options.
Customization is a significant cost driver. The data indicates that "Customization" and "Customized" are available attributes, allowing buyers to tailor the cart to their specific brand identity. This can include custom colors, with options ranging from "Any Ral Color" to specific customizations for the roof and dimensions. The ability to customize the roof and dimensions to fit specific venue requirements adds to the manufacturing complexity and cost. Furthermore, the inclusion of advanced features such as a "Smart Thermostat" for temperature control, which is essential for maintaining the quality of Italian ice cream, gelato, and popsicles, also contributes to the higher price points.
The minimum order quantity (MOQ) is another factor that affects the overall cost structure. The observed MOQ range is between 1 and 5 units, suggesting that suppliers are flexible enough to accommodate small business owners or individual entrepreneurs. However, for buyers seeking to equip multiple locations or launch a fleet, negotiating a lower unit price based on volume may be possible, though the specific pricing tiers are not explicitly defined in the available data. The "Service Life" of 5 years and the "1 Year" warranty period are also critical considerations when calculating the total cost of ownership. A longer service life and comprehensive warranty can justify a higher initial investment by reducing long-term maintenance and replacement costs.

Supplier Evaluation and Quality Assurance Strategies
Evaluating suppliers for luxury mobile ice cream carts requires a systematic approach that goes beyond the initial product listing. The "prod_origin" data shows that the majority of these units originate from China, specifically from regions like Jiangsu and Henan. While this provides a broad pool of potential suppliers, buyers must conduct due diligence to ensure the quality and reliability of the manufacturer. The "Video Outgoing-Inspection" being provided is a positive indicator of a supplier's commitment to transparency and quality control. Buyers should request these videos to verify the construction quality, the finish of the non-slip flooring, and the overall assembly of the unit.
The "Material" attribute, which can be "Customized" or specifically "304 Stainless Steel," is a key metric for supplier evaluation. Suppliers who offer high-grade stainless steel demonstrate a commitment to durability and food safety. Buyers should also verify the "prod_packing" standards, such as the "Fumigation-Free Wooden Case" or "Wooden Box," to ensure that the unit will arrive in pristine condition and comply with international shipping regulations. The "Standard" dimensions and "Specification" models like A-107, MR6, and HT-KNB6 provide a baseline for comparison, but buyers should request detailed technical drawings and material certificates to confirm that the specific unit meets their requirements.
Quality assurance should also extend to the supplier's after-sales support. The "Warrenty" of 1 year and the "Service Life" of 5 years are critical indicators of the supplier's confidence in their product. Buyers should inquire about the availability of spare parts, the process for handling warranty claims, and the technical support offered for troubleshooting. The "Color" options, ranging from "Black" to "Any Ral Color," should be verified to ensure that the supplier can meet the buyer's branding requirements without compromising the structural integrity of the cart.
